Kan någon förklara varför jag får följande fel då jag kör dessa rader: Testa att ändra din cursortyp från adForwardOnly till adOpenStatic (1).Cannot create new connection because in manual or distributed transaction mode
Jag skapar ett connectionobject högst upp i koden som används på hela sidan. Koden nedan körs då jag klickar på en delete knapp och ligger i en if-sats.
Detta fel skrivs ut: Varför?
-2147467259 Cannot create new connection because in manual or distributed transaction mode.
<code>
conn.BeginTrans
On error Resume Next
sql = "DELETE FROM db_Imports WHERE rangeID = "&rangeid&""
conn.execute(sql)
sql = "DELETE FROM db_Ranges WHERE rangeID = "&rangeid
conn.execute(sql)
errnumber = err.Number
errdescription = err.Description
err.clear
on error goto 0
if len(errnumber) > 0 and len(errdescription) > 0 then
strError = errnumber & " " & errdescription
conn.RollbackTrans
Response.Redirect("c.asp?id="&cID&"&error="&strError&"")
else
conn.CommitTrans
failed = sendmail (rangestart, rangeend, campaignID, saljare, customerfile)
Response.Redirect("c.asp?id="&cID&"&error="&failed&"")
end if
</code>Sv: Cannot create new connection because in manual or distributed transaction mo